Technological innovation is leading the way in several business areas, including how accounting is currently done. Accountants need to keep up to date with technological advances to respond to market conditions and customer needs. Digital resources and online tools improve productivity and organization. Manual accounting has virtually disappeared and has been replaced by online accounting. Online accounting not only reduces errors, but provides more accurate data, among other advantages.
One of them is the virtual storage of data, which makes the process cheaper, reducing paper records and physical space, since the digitization of documents is gradually replacing physical storage. Online accounting also eliminates red tape, using simple and intuitive platforms that provide direct channels to clients, in addition to information and documents that can be digitized. Dedicated platforms make communication easier and more instantaneous, which for many clients translates into time savings and greater efficiency. This flexibility also saves time, as the platforms provide online management tools, which help with completing tasks and achieving goals.
Online accounting also has virtual calendars, including alerts that contribute to meeting deadlines. They are tools that are easily accessible through mobile devices and whose updates are instantly shared with the team involved.
Some digital platforms offer specific tools for accountants, regularly providing updates on changes in legislation. This is why it has become so important that accountants are aware of the latest technological advances in the area and use them to boost their clients' businesses. By using additional tools, such as automation and reporting, you're sure to see an increase in productivity, professional efficiency, and customer satisfaction.
